@font-face {
  font-family: 'Varela Round';
  src: url('VarelaRound-Regular.ttf') format('truetype');
} 

body{
	font: 16px/22px 'Varela Round', sans-serif;
 }
 
 /************* Footer in middle on small screen ***************/
@media screen and (max-width: 767px){
	#footer-bar-1-col-1 p, #footer-bar-1-col-2 div, #footer-bar-1-col-3 div, #footer-bar-1-col-4 p {
		margin: 0 auto;
		width: 70%;
	}
}

#block-block-3, #block-block-4, #block-block-5, .pd_class{
	padding: 50px 0;
}

.home-flyers-vertical-box{
	padding-bottom: 20px;
}

#footer-bar-1 .content, #service-view, #deal-view{
	display: table;
}

.footer-panel, .service-view-node, .deal-view-node {
    display: inline-block;
    float: none;
    vertical-align: top;
    margin: 30px 0;
}

ul.about-home-icon{
    list-style-type: none;
	padding-left: 20px;
}

ul.about-home-icon li{
    position: relative;
	padding-left: 25px;
	margin-bottom: 10px
}

ul.about-home-icon li:before{
    position: absolute;
	top: 0;
	left: 0;
	font-family: FontAwesome;
	content: "\f0f1";
	color: #eb7d08;
}

.home-service-vertical-box img{
	margin: auto;
	margin-bottom: 10px;
}

.home-service-vertical-box h3 a{
	text-align: center;
	margin-bottom: 40px;
}
.home-service-vertical-box h3 a:hover{
	color:#000;
}

.home-flyers-vertical-box img{
	margin: auto;
	margin-bottom: 30px;
}

.webform-client-form-1 input{
	width: 100%;
}

.webform-client-form-1 input[type="submit"]{
	width: inherit;
}

.cert-div{
	padding-bottom: 40px;
}

.home-service img, .home-flyers img, .cert-div img, .service-view-node img, .deal-view-node img{
    -webkit-border-radius: 14px;
    -moz-border-radius: 14px;
    border-radius: 14px;
}

.box1, .box2{
	float: right;
	clear:both;
}

.box2 img{
	display:inline;
}

.element-invisible{
	display: none;
}

#social{
	font-size: 20px;
}